I'd love Alonso as my team-mate at Renault - Ocon

Esteban Ocon has revealed he would love to see Fernando Alonso return to Formula 1 and become his team-mate with Renault from next year. Renault is currently weighing up its options following Daniel Ricciardo's decision to leave the team at the end of this year to join McLaren, with Alonso and Sebastian Vettel understood to be top of the shortlist. Article continues under video With Ocon with the team on a two-year contract, he heads into the new campaign that starts in Austria on Sunday partly wondering who will be alongside him in 2021 - his preferred option that of double world champion Alonso.
